Abstract

密度泛函 電子結構 第一原理 Density Functional Theory Electronic Structure First-Principle
Based on first principles, we use GGA and PAW method in the framework of density functional theory to investigate electronic structure of perovskite ruthenate CaRuO3. Additionally, we also perform GGA+U calculation to include the on site Coulomb interaction of Ru ion. The total-energy studies show that CaRuO3 stabilize in metallic conducting ground state with ferromagnetic ordering. Furthermore, the calculation show that it is necessary to carry out GGA+U scheme and structure optimization on this system.
